Kazakhstan award confirmed in US after fraud defence excluded
The Capitol Building in Washington, DC (Credit: istock.com/MikeyLPT)
A US court has enforced a US$520 million Energy Charter Treaty award in favour of Moldovan investors Anatolie and Gabriel Stati against Kazakhstan, after refusing for a second time to allow the state to introduce allegations of fraud as a defence.
